Charles Cunningham Obituary

Charles Cunningham PORTSMOUTH - Charles H. "Chick" Cunningham, 79, of Hunters Point, died Nov. 4, 2009. Mr. Cunningham, a native of Portsmouth, retired in 1991 from the Norfolk Southern Railroad as an engineer after 35 years of service. He later worked as an investigator for the law firm of Wilson, Hajek, Shapiro, Cooper & Lewis. He was a member of St. Paul's Catholic Church, the Brotherhood of Locomotive Engineers, and Knights of Columbus 418. He was a U.S. Air Force veteran. Survivors include his daughter, Rebecca Heroux and husband Dustin and their children Kaytlynn and Kelly Heroux; three stepchildren, Ricky L. Turner, Sheryl T. Bryan, Brian Turner, all of Portsmouth; seven stepgrandchildren; sister, Mae Cunningham Wakefield; niece, Mary Ann Viola; and his former wife, Jacqueline Skipwith Cunningham. A Mass of Christian burial will be celebrated at 11 a.m. Tuesday in St. Paul's Catholic Church by the Rev. David Cupps. Burial will follow in Portsmouth Catholic Cemetery. A Christian wake will be held at 7 p.m. Monday in Foster Funeral Home, Portsmouth.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to the American Heart Association.
